Coal India’s production rises by 11% to 47.3 MT in July

01 Aug 2022 Evaluate

Coal India’s (CIL) coal production has increased by 11.1% to 47.3 million tonnes (MT) in July 2022 as against 42.6 MT in July 2021. The company’s production in the April- July 2022 period increased 24.3 per cent to 207.1 MT, compared with 166.6 MT in the year-ago period.    

The company's offtake increased by 8.1% to 54.5 MT in July, 2022, over 50.4 MT in the corresponding month of the previous financial year. Its offtake in the April- July 2022 period also increased by 10% to 232.0 MT over 210.9 MT in the year-ago period.    

Coal India is the world’s largest coal mining company. It also produces non-coking coal and coking coal of various grades for diverse applications.
